Troops of the 22 Armoured Brigade deployed at the Forward Operating Base (FOB) Patigi have arrested eight suspected kidnappers and rescued two victims.

In a significant breakthrough in the fight against insecurity, Nigerian troops have arrested eight suspected kidnappers and successfully rescued several abducted victims during a military operation in Kwara State.

According to a statement released on Sunday by military authorities, the operation was carried out following credible intelligence on the activities of a kidnapping syndicate operating in parts of the state. The troops stormed the criminals' hideout in a swift and coordinated assault that caught the suspects off guard.

“The suspects were apprehended during a clearance operation in the forested areas between Ifelodun and Moro Local Government Areas,” the statement read. “All kidnapped victims were rescued unharmed and have been reunited with their families.”

Weapons, mobile phones, and personal items belonging to the victims were recovered from the suspects. The arrested individuals are currently in military custody and will be handed over to relevant security agencies for further investigation and prosecution.

The operation has been praised by local leaders and residents, who expressed relief over the growing presence and effectiveness of security forces in the region. They also called for continued military pressure to eradicate criminal networks threatening peace in the state.

This development comes amid ongoing nationwide efforts by the Nigerian Armed Forces to tackle insecurity, including banditry, kidnapping, and terrorism, especially in rural and forested areas.
